The position of Class 1 Trunk Driver has arisen within our Argyll depot. The successful candidate must be motivated, great customer service skills and have an excellent work ethic.
Main Roles & Responsibilities:
- Shunting vehicles safely within the depot
- Operating a forklift (where required)
- Collecting and delivering freight (as role develops)
- Demonstrating good health and safety practices at all times
- Assisting with loading and scanning of your own and other vehicles
- Ensuring high standards of housekeeping within the depot
- Manual handling duties
- Using electronic devices for scanning and proof of delivery (PODs)
Advantageous:
- Previous experience in a similar role (shunting/forklift/trunking)
- Clean driving licence
- ADR qualification
- Forklift licence/experience
Required:
- Cat C+E Licence (held for a minimum of 2 years)
- Valid CPC
- Digital Tachograph Card
- Forklift Certificate
